U.S. Military Tests Hypersonic Waverider X-51A Over The Pacific



U.S. Military Tests Hypersonic Waverider Aircraft Over Pacific -- Reuters

* Aircraft designed to fly from LA to NYC in less than an hour
* Test results to be announced Wednesday

LOS ANGELES, Aug 14 (Reuters) - The U.S. military conducted an unmanned test flight on Tuesday of its hypersonic Waverider aircraft, designed to move at six times the speed of sound using technology that bridges the gap between planes and rocketships, a military official said.

A B-52 bomber launched the remotely monitored, nearly wingless experimental aircraft, officially known as the X-51A, between 10 a.m. and 11 a.m. (1700 and 1800 GMT), John Haire, a spokesman for the 412th test wing at Edwards Air Force Base in California, said in a statement. Results of the brief test flight will be released on Wednesday, he said.
